Academic Comparison between Cairn and Cabrini

Cairn University-Langhorne and Cabrini University are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Both Sch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) and located in Pennsylvania

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• Both sch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) schools.
  • Cabrini has more expensive tuition & fees ($35,815) than Cairn ($33,659).
  • Cairn has more students with 1,097 students while Cabrini has 1,048 students.
  • Cabrini has a lower number of students per faculty with 9 to 1 while Cairn's ratio is 11 to 1.
  • Cabrini has more full-time faculties with 55 faculties while Cairn has 46 full-time faculties.
